We believe that the way people interact with their finances will drastically improve in the next few years. We’re dedicated to
empowering this transformation by building the tools and experiences that thousands of developers use to create their own
products. Plaid powers the tools millions of people rely on to live a healthier financial life. We work with thousands of
companies like Venmo, SoFi, several of the Fortune 500, and many of the largest banks to make it easy for people to connect their
financial accounts to the apps and services they want to use. Plaid’s network covers 12,000 financial institutions across the US,
Canada, UK and Europe. Founded in 2013, the company is headquartered in San Francisco with offices in New York, Washington D.C.,
London and Amsterdam.
Plaid is in one of the most exciting chapters in its history — and this role exists to make sure every Plaid employee feels it. As
Internal Communications Lead, you'll build and own the systems, channels, and programs that keep Plaids informed, aligned, and
energized about our mission and the opportunity ahead. This spans employee-facing comms and programming across channels, including
programming and producing monthly All Hands and Half-yearly Business Reviews, and supporting leaders with change management.
This is a builder role: you'll take what exists and programmatize it, defining the infrastructure, cadences, and editorial
strategy that elevate how we communicate as a company.
You'll play a central role in shaping Plaid's internal AI narrative, helping employees understand where AI is taking us and what
it means for their work.
You'll operate as a trusted advisor to Plaid's executive team and founder CEO, with the exec presence and judgment to counsel
leaders on high-stakes moments. You will also work closely with senior leaders across the org as well as cross functional partners
across the people team (Chief People Officer, HRBPs, WPE, Comp, Learning and Development)

Plaid’s go-to-market Partnerships team drives growth by building and scaling relationships with strategic partners. Through integrations, these partners help extend Plaid’s Credit, Lending, and Banking solutions to more businesses and consumers. Partner Marketing plays a critical role in this ecosystem, enabling partners to attract, engage, and onboard customers at scale—making it one of the most effective levers for accelerating growth across Plaid’s partner network. We're looking for a Partner Marketing Manager to own the design and execution of joint marketing programs with Plaid's partners. This role is responsible for translating business objectives into clear GTM plans — covering propositions, launches, campaigns, enablement, and performance measurement — and acting as the primary marketing contact for partners across key product areas. Sitting within the Growth Marketing organization, you'll report to the Customer & Partner Marketing Lead and work alongside the Partner Marketing Manager. This is a high-impact, highly collaborative role for someone who enjoys building strong partner relationships, influencing across teams, and turning complex product positioning into compelling marketing that drives real pipeline. Responsibilities GTM Strategy & Planning * Partner closely with Partnership Leaders to understand key priorities and identify where we have marketing leverage * Translate business objectives into clear GTM plans covering propositions, launches, campaigns, enablement, and performance measurement * Identify and develop partner-led propositions that meet partner needs while aligning to Plaid's company goals Co-Marketing & Campaigns * Create and execute co-marketing campaigns with partners to drive awareness, demand, and adoption * Develop scalable content campaigns to engage a broad range of existing partners * Analyze performance data to optimize campaigns and improve ROI across the partner channel Partner Enablement * Act as the primary GTM contact for partners on propositions, launches, campaigns, and enablement * Create partner-ready enablement materials including decks, guides, FAQs, and onboarding content * Ensure partners are launch-ready and confident to sell effectively Cross-Functional Collaboration * Deeply understand Plaid's product areas across Credit, Lending, and Banking and translate them into partner-relevant messaging * Influence and organise stakeholders across partnerships, account management, product marketing, and communications to deliver against joint marketing plans * Manage timelines, approvals, and dependencies across multiple internal and external stakeholders * Monitor and analyze program performance, preparing clear updates and insights to support optimization and reporting Qualifications * 6–8+ years of relevant B2B marketing experience, including roles focused on partner or channel marketing * Experience working closely with technology and/or consulting partners to build joint marketing plans that drive customer acquisition and pipeline generation * Proven ability to influence partner marketing leadership teams and align on joint objectives and priorities * Experience shaping joint messaging with partners and translating product positioning into partner-ready content * Demonstrated ability to measure and improve ROI of marketing investments through an indirect/partner business model * Deep understanding of the partner channel funnel, sales cycle, and product lifecycle * Strong cross-functional skills with the ability to align stakeholders across partnerships, product marketing, product, and communications * Comfortable engaging with enterprise-level stakeholders and presenting to senior audiences * Experience at a high-growth technology company * Experience in payments, financial technology, Credit, Lending, or Banking * Background in partner enablement, revenue enablement, or sales enablement * Experience with marketing automation platforms (Marketo, HubSpot) or CRM (Salesforce) * Experience working with learning management systems (LetterAI) and employee enablement intranet platforms. * Strong ability to leverage AI (ChatGPT, Claude, Glean) tools and technologies to improve efficiency, automate workflows, and scale impact.
